**Q: How does my plugin request a locker door open on behalf of a user?**

A: Plugins never open doors directly. You submit an access intent to the Tumblegate broker, which validates the user's active reservation, locker assignment, and time window before issuing a one-shot unlock token. Tokens expire after 90 seconds and are bound to a single door. If validation fails, you receive a structured denial reason you should surface verbatim. The complete intent schema and denial codes are documented on the page below.

dashboard of tawef-hagug = https://superset.norvadyn.local/display/projects/build/ticket/build/spaces/ticket/1e989f0e6c200d20fc4ae06b

Handover — Vexler partner SFTP drop

Ownership moves to you today. Drop runs hourly from Vexler's end into the intake bucket via the relay host. Watch for zero-byte files; their exporter flakes on Mondays. Creds live in the ops vault, path noted in the runbook. Vault auto-seals after 48h idle. Support escalations go to the on-call rotation, not me. If the vault is sealed when you need it, unseal with the recovery passphrase below.

recovery phrase for tadug-fafof: zorwyn-kasion

## Wavelet Preview Service — Environments

Quick rundown for release planning: the Wavelet service renders audio waveform previews for uploads on Soundgrove. Staging uses a smaller render pool than production, so don't panic if previews lag there. Both environments share the same renderer build. The production environment runs with the following configuration values.

config for kafof-bawef:
holath:
  log_level: debug
  metrics_host: metrics.holath.qorvelsys.internal
  pin: 2191
  pool_size: 32

// SCALER_MAX_QUEUE_DEPTH
// Heads up for whoever's reviewing this from the security side: this cap
// is what keeps the Wrenlet autoscaler from spinning up workers forever
// when the intake queue gets poisoned by junk messages. Lowering it is
// safe; raising it needs sign-off because each worker gets broker creds.
// The scaler reads this once at boot, so a redeploy is required to change
// it. The deploy that last touched this value is stamped with the trace
// token on the next line.

session token of yajof-bagef = htk4_937d